我应该在部署之前构建一个 typescript npm 模块吗?

Am I supposed to build a typescript npm module before deployment?

我正在尝试弄清楚如何使用我在 JavaScript 应用程序中制作的 Typescript 包。我 运行 遇到的主要问题是我不确定我是否应该先构建打字稿包然后使用 npm 本地导入它,或者如果有一个自动构建过程 npm 将运行 安装我可以利用的包时。在这方面的任何帮助都会很棒!

在我看来,最好在部署之前先构建,然后用 npm 发布 .js.d.ts 文件。

安装时构建可能会失败,与发布时调试构建失败相比,这对您来说更难调试。您可以查看 this issue 的示例,了解构建如何因未知原因出错。